Output 3e5ce51dd7551f718fa1307a6c1227c03ea615731d332eb367bb94af96496621:19

value
4302912
script pubkey
OP_0 OP_PUSHBYTES_20 5e2e9e256600251171aae664599df3b532395a5c
address
bc1qtchfuftxqqj3zud2uej9n80nk5erjkjuazqa8e
transaction
3e5ce51dd7551f718fa1307a6c1227c03ea615731d332eb367bb94af96496621
spent
true